1. Understand Oracle's Licensing Model

In order to negotiate effectively with Oracle, it is crucial to have a comprehensive understanding of their licensing model. Oracle offers various licensing options, including perpetual licenses, term licenses, and cloud subscriptions. Each licensing model has its own terms and conditions, pricing structure, and usage rights. Familiarize yourself with these models and determine which one aligns best with your organization's needs and budget.

Additionally, Oracle follows a complex metric system to determine the number of licenses required. These metrics can include processor licenses, named user licenses, or other measures based on the specific product. Conduct a thorough evaluation of your organization's usage patterns and requirements to accurately estimate the number of licenses needed and negotiate accordingly.

Furthermore, keeping up-to-date with Oracle's licensing policies and any updates or changes they make is essential. By staying informed, you can ensure you negotiate based on the latest policies and guidelines.

2. Review Maintenance and Support Costs

Oracle software typically includes maintenance and support services, which can account for a significant portion of the overall costs. During negotiations, evaluate the maintenance and support fees and negotiate for any reductions or alternative options that may be available.

Consider the specific support services your organization requires and negotiate for a tailored package that aligns with your needs. You may be able to negotiate for a reduced support fee based on the level of support required or opt for a different support model, such as self-service support.

3. Seek Flexibility in Usage Rights

In addition to pricing considerations, negotiate for flexibility in usage rights within your license agreement. This flexibility can include options to transfer licenses between systems, expand usage to different environments, or adjust license quantities based on changing business needs.

By securing favorable usage rights, you can optimize your software usage and adapt to changing organizational requirements without incurring additional costs or penalties.

4. Consider Third-Party Support Options

Oracle software support and maintenance fees can be substantial. As an alternative, consider exploring third-party support providers that offer similar services at a lower cost. Third-party support can often provide comparable support levels while offering greater flexibility and potential cost savings.

When negotiating with Oracle, make them aware of the availability of third-party support options. This knowledge can potentially incentivize Oracle to offer more competitive pricing or alternative support arrangements.
